Module:ElectrolyzerRecipeDictionary: Difference between revisions

From Evospace
Jump to navigation Jump to search
Created page with "return { { name = 'Hydrogen', ingredients = { {'Water', 800}, }, results = { {'Hydrogen', 400}, }, time = 200, tier = 4, }, { name = 'Oxygen', ingredients = { {'Water', 800}, }, results = { {'Oxygen', 200}, }, time = 200, tier = 4, }, { name = 'CinnabarDust', ingredients = {..."
 
No edit summary
 
Line 2: Line 2:
     {
     {
         name = 'Hydrogen',
         name = 'Hydrogen',
         ingredients = {
         input = {
             {'Water', 800},
             {'Water', 800},
         },
         },
         results = {
         output = {
             {'Hydrogen', 400},
             {'Hydrogen', 400},
         },
         },
         time = 200,
         ticks = 200,
         tier = 4,
         tier = 4,
     },
     },
     {
     {
         name = 'Oxygen',
         name = 'Oxygen',
         ingredients = {
         input = {
             {'Water', 800},
             {'Water', 800},
         },
         },
         results = {
         output = {
             {'Oxygen', 200},
             {'Oxygen', 200},
         },
         },
         time = 200,
         ticks = 200,
         tier = 4,
         tier = 4,
     },
     },
     {
     {
         name = 'CinnabarDust',
         name = 'CinnabarDust',
         ingredients = {
         input = {
             {'CinnabarDust', 2},
             {'CinnabarDust', 2},
         },
         },
         results = {
         output = {
             {'Sulfur', 1},
             {'Sulfur', 1},
             {'Mercury', 200},
             {'Mercury', 200},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'MalachiteCrystal',
         name = 'MalachiteCrystal',
         ingredients = {
         input = {
             {'MalachiteCrystal', 1},
             {'MalachiteCrystal', 1},
         },
         },
         results = {
         output = {
             {'MalachiteDust', 3},
             {'MalachiteDust', 3},
             {'BerylliumDust', 1},
             {'BerylliumDust', 1},
         },
         },
         time = 80,
         ticks = 80,
         tier = 3,
         tier = 3,
     },
     },
     {
     {
         name = 'ThorianiteCrystal',
         name = 'ThorianiteCrystal',
         ingredients = {
         input = {
             {'ThorianiteCrystal', 1},
             {'ThorianiteCrystal', 1},
         },
         },
         results = {
         output = {
             {'UraniumDust', 3},
             {'UraniumDust', 3},
             {'Uranium235Dust', 1},
             {'Uranium235Dust', 1},
         },
         },
         time = 80,
         ticks = 80,
         tier = 3,
         tier = 3,
     },
     },
     {
     {
         name = 'ElectrolyzerPyriteDust',
         name = 'ElectrolyzerPyriteDust',
         ingredients = {
         input = {
             {'PyriteDust', 2},
             {'PyriteDust', 2},
         },
         },
         results = {
         output = {
             {'IronDust', 1},
             {'IronDust', 1},
             {'Sulfur', 1},
             {'Sulfur', 1},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'ElectrolyzerChalcopyriteDust',
         name = 'ElectrolyzerChalcopyriteDust',
         ingredients = {
         input = {
             {'ChalcopyriteDust', 2},
             {'ChalcopyriteDust', 2},
         },
         },
         results = {
         output = {
             {'CopperDust', 1},
             {'CopperDust', 1},
             {'Sulfur', 1},
             {'Sulfur', 1},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'ElectrolyzerMagnetiteDust',
         name = 'ElectrolyzerMagnetiteDust',
         ingredients = {
         input = {
             {'MagnetiteDust', 2},
             {'MagnetiteDust', 2},
         },
         },
         results = {
         output = {
             {'IronDust', 1},
             {'IronDust', 1},
             {'Oxygen', 1000},
             {'Oxygen', 1000},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'ElectrolyzerMalachiteDust',
         name = 'ElectrolyzerMalachiteDust',
         ingredients = {
         input = {
             {'MalachiteDust', 2},
             {'MalachiteDust', 2},
         },
         },
         results = {
         output = {
             {'CopperDust', 1},
             {'CopperDust', 1},
             {'Oxygen', 1000},
             {'Oxygen', 1000},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'ElectrolyzerBauxiteDust',
         name = 'ElectrolyzerBauxiteDust',
         ingredients = {
         input = {
             {'BauxiteDust', 12},
             {'BauxiteDust', 12},
         },
         },
         results = {
         output = {
             {'AluminiumOxideDust', 6},
             {'AluminiumOxideDust', 6},
             {'TitaniumOxideDust', 1},
             {'TitaniumOxideDust', 1},
             {'Oxygen', 5000},
             {'Oxygen', 5000},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'ElectrolyzerRubyDust',
         name = 'ElectrolyzerRubyDust',
         ingredients = {
         input = {
             {'RubyDust', 8},
             {'RubyDust', 8},
         },
         },
         results = {
         output = {
             {'AluminiumOxideDust', 4},
             {'AluminiumOxideDust', 4},
             {'ChromiumDust', 1},
             {'ChromiumDust', 1},
             {'Oxygen', 3000},
             {'Oxygen', 3000},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'AluminiumOxideDust',
         name = 'AluminiumOxideDust',
         ingredients = {
         input = {
             {'AluminiumOxideDust', 1},
             {'AluminiumOxideDust', 1},
         },
         },
         results = {
         output = {
             {'AluminiumDust', 1},
             {'AluminiumDust', 1},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'SandElectrolyze',
         name = 'SandElectrolyze',
         ingredients = {
         input = {
             {'SiliconOxide', 1},
             {'SiliconOxide', 1},
         },
         },
         results = {
         output = {
             {'Silicon', 1},
             {'Silicon', 1},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
     {
     {
         name = 'SaltElectrolyze',
         name = 'SaltElectrolyze',
         ingredients = {
         input = {
             {'Salt', 1},
             {'Salt', 1},
         },
         },
         results = {
         output = {
             {'Chlorine', 1000},
             {'Chlorine', 1000},
         },
         },
         time = 200,
         ticks = 200,
         tier = 2,
         tier = 2,
     },
     },
}
}

Latest revision as of 12:37, 31 July 2025

Documentation for this module may be created at Module:ElectrolyzerRecipeDictionary/doc

return {
    {
        name = 'Hydrogen',
        input = {
            {'Water', 800},
        },
        output = {
            {'Hydrogen', 400},
        },
        ticks = 200,
        tier = 4,
    },
    {
        name = 'Oxygen',
        input = {
            {'Water', 800},
        },
        output = {
            {'Oxygen', 200},
        },
        ticks = 200,
        tier = 4,
    },
    {
        name = 'CinnabarDust',
        input = {
            {'CinnabarDust', 2},
        },
        output = {
            {'Sulfur', 1},
            {'Mercury', 200},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'MalachiteCrystal',
        input = {
            {'MalachiteCrystal', 1},
        },
        output = {
            {'MalachiteDust', 3},
            {'BerylliumDust', 1},
        },
        ticks = 80,
        tier = 3,
    },
    {
        name = 'ThorianiteCrystal',
        input = {
            {'ThorianiteCrystal', 1},
        },
        output = {
            {'UraniumDust', 3},
            {'Uranium235Dust', 1},
        },
        ticks = 80,
        tier = 3,
    },
    {
        name = 'ElectrolyzerPyriteDust',
        input = {
            {'PyriteDust', 2},
        },
        output = {
            {'IronDust', 1},
            {'Sulfur', 1},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'ElectrolyzerChalcopyriteDust',
        input = {
            {'ChalcopyriteDust', 2},
        },
        output = {
            {'CopperDust', 1},
            {'Sulfur', 1},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'ElectrolyzerMagnetiteDust',
        input = {
            {'MagnetiteDust', 2},
        },
        output = {
            {'IronDust', 1},
            {'Oxygen', 1000},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'ElectrolyzerMalachiteDust',
        input = {
            {'MalachiteDust', 2},
        },
        output = {
            {'CopperDust', 1},
            {'Oxygen', 1000},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'ElectrolyzerBauxiteDust',
        input = {
            {'BauxiteDust', 12},
        },
        output = {
            {'AluminiumOxideDust', 6},
            {'TitaniumOxideDust', 1},
            {'Oxygen', 5000},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'ElectrolyzerRubyDust',
        input = {
            {'RubyDust', 8},
        },
        output = {
            {'AluminiumOxideDust', 4},
            {'ChromiumDust', 1},
            {'Oxygen', 3000},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'AluminiumOxideDust',
        input = {
            {'AluminiumOxideDust', 1},
        },
        output = {
            {'AluminiumDust', 1},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'SandElectrolyze',
        input = {
            {'SiliconOxide', 1},
        },
        output = {
            {'Silicon', 1},
        },
        ticks = 200,
        tier = 2,
    },
    {
        name = 'SaltElectrolyze',
        input = {
            {'Salt', 1},
        },
        output = {
            {'Chlorine', 1000},
        },
        ticks = 200,
        tier = 2,
    },
}